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Eulenkopfmeerkatze | Maskenkiebitz |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Tier)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ordatiere) | Chordata (Chordatiere) |
| Class | Mammalia (Säugetiere) | Aves (Vögel) |
| Order | Primates (Primaten) | Charadriiformes (Regenpfeiferartige) |
| Family |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) | Charadriidae |
| Genus | Cercopithecus | Vanellus |
| Species | Cercopithecus hamlyni | Vanellus miles |
Evolutionary Relationship
Eulenkopfmeerkatze and Maskenkiebitz share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ordatiere)
